The Kansas City Royals (32-29) are set to face the St. Louis Cardinals (33-27) in a matchup that highlights two teams with contrasting recent performances. The Royals enter the game on a one-game winning streak, while the Cardinals are looking to break a two-game losing streak.

At home, the Cardinals have a strong record of 19-9, contributing to a winning percentage of .550. In contrast, the Royals have struggled on the road with a 13-16 record, resulting in a .525 winning percentage. Key players to watch include the Royals’ Bobby Witt Jr., who leads the team with 35 RBIs and 20 stolen bases, and the Cardinals’ Thomas Saggese, boasting a batting average of .341. This game promises to be a competitive encounter as both teams aim to improve their standings.

St. Louis Cardinals Injury Report

Zack Thompson – Lat (D60) – The St. Louis Cardinals transferred LHP Zack Thompson from the 15-day injured list to the 60-day injured list with a tear in the left side lat muscle.
Jordan Walker – Wrist (D10) – The St. Louis Cardinals placed OF Jordan Walker on the 10-day injured list due to a left wrist inflammation.

Kansas City Royals Injury Report

Maikel Garcia – Thumb (Day-to-Day) – Garcia was scratched from Sunday’s lineup against Detroit with a thumb injury.
Alec Marsh – Shoulder (D60) – The Kansas City Royals placed RHP Alec Marsh on the 60-day injured list while rehabbing his injured right shoulder.
James McArthur – Elbow (D60) – The Kansas City Royals transferred RHP James McArthur from the 15-day injured list to the 60-day injured list which was due to an elbow olecranon surgery.
Lucas Erceg – Back (D15) – The Kansas City Royals placed RHP Lucas Erceg on the 15-day injured list due to a low back strain.
Cole Ragans – Groin (D15) – The Kansas City Royals placed LHP Cole Ragans on the 15-day injured list due to a left groin strain.
Hunter Harvey – Shoulder (D15) – The Kansas City Royals placed RHP Hunter Harvey on the 15-day injured list with a right teres major strain.
Sam Long – Elbow (D15) – The Kansas City Royals placed LHP Sam Long on the 15-day injured list with a left elbow inflammation.
Kyle Wright – Shoulder (D15) – The Kansas City Royals placed RHP Kyle Wright on the 15-day injured list due to a shoulder surgery.
